P035PJE120AT1B2
6 month ago

IGBT-Inverter
Maximum Rated Values
Symbo |
Description |
Conditions |
Values |
Unit |
VCES |
Collector-Emitter Voltage |
Ty=25℃ |
1200 |
V |
VGEs |
Gate-Emitter Peak Voltage |
Ty=25℃ |
±20 |
V |
Ic |
Continuous DC Collector Current |
Tc=100℃ |
35 |
A |
CRM |
Repetitive Peak Collector Current |
tp=1ms |
70 |
A |
Ptot |
Total Power Dissipation |
Tc=25℃,Tyimax=175℃ |
172 |
W |
